Index: ios/chrome/browser/ui/settings/sync_encryption_passphrase_collection_view_controller_unittest.mm |
diff --git a/ios/chrome/browser/ui/settings/sync_encryption_passphrase_collection_view_controller_unittest.mm b/ios/chrome/browser/ui/settings/sync_encryption_passphrase_collection_view_controller_unittest.mm |
index 8248e6f3a5256966015650df60eb833a3c3a0d60..f13f0a34e32f9b2a16148c398bfb9367f63bbabe 100644 |
--- a/ios/chrome/browser/ui/settings/sync_encryption_passphrase_collection_view_controller_unittest.mm |
+++ b/ios/chrome/browser/ui/settings/sync_encryption_passphrase_collection_view_controller_unittest.mm |
@@ -9,7 +9,6 @@ |
#include <memory> |
#include "base/compiler_specific.h" |
-#import "base/mac/scoped_nsobject.h" |
#include "base/memory/ptr_util.h" |
#include "base/message_loop/message_loop.h" |
#include "base/strings/sys_string_conversions.h" |
@@ -30,6 +29,10 @@ |
#include "ui/base/l10n/l10n_util.h" |
#include "ui/base/l10n/l10n_util_mac.h" |
+#if !defined(__has_feature) || !__has_feature(objc_arc) |
+#error "This file requires ARC support." |
+#endif |
+ |
namespace { |
using testing::_; |
@@ -85,7 +88,7 @@ class SyncEncryptionPassphraseCollectionViewControllerTest |
PassphraseCollectionViewControllerTest::TearDown(); |
} |
- CollectionViewController* NewController() override NS_RETURNS_RETAINED { |
+ CollectionViewController* InstantiateController() override { |
return [[SyncEncryptionPassphraseCollectionViewController alloc] |
initWithBrowserState:chrome_browser_state_.get()]; |
} |